Class I— FDA's most serious classification, issued when there is a reasonable probability that consumption of or exposure to the product will cause serious adverse health consequences or death.

Product

Blueberry Muffin, brand Surtidoras Bakery, net wt. 1.74 lbs., packaged in rigid plastic clam shell container. No UPC. The allergens declared in the INGREDIENTS statement: "***ENRICHED WHEAT FLOUR *** SOYBEAN OIL***WHEY***WHEAT GLUTEN***EGGS*** SOY FLOUR***SOYBEAN OIL AND WHOLE EGGS***". The allergens declared in the CONTAINS statement: "CONTAINS: WHEAT, EGG, AND SOY".

Type
Food
Affected lot / code info
SELL BY Dates: 03/18/19 and includes up to 3/26/19.
Quantity
44 packages

Why it was recalled

The ingredients statement declared wheat, soybean oil, eggs, soy flour, soybean oil, and WHEY. The ingredients statement does not declare Milk as a source of whey and the Contains statement does not declare Milk.
